Solve for $X$
$$ A^{-1} \, X \, B-B=-A^{-1} \, X $$
$$ A = \begin{bmatrix}1&-1\\1&2\end{bmatrix} \quad B = \begin{bmatrix}-1&1\\2&1\end{bmatrix} $$

$$A^{-1}XB-B=-A^{-1}X \\XB-AB=-X \\ X(B+I)=AB \\ X=(AB)(B+I)^{-1}$$
